Association 'delighted and honoured' to be shortlisted
The restoration of a steam railway locomotive on the Isle of Man has been nominated for a UK award.
The Isle of Man Steam Railway Supporters Association has announced the cosmetic revamp of No.5 Mona has been shortlisted for a potential honour by the Heritage Railway Association.
It'll be one of ten projects to compete for the award alongside competitors from the likes of The Corris Railway, The Eastwell History Group and The Foxfield Railway.
The association says it's 'delighted and honoured' to have received the nomination, adding it marks the 'perfect start to the year' in which the 150th anniversary of the Port Erin line will be held from 30 July to 4 August, 2024.
